expand_more To find elements by attribute in Beautiful Soup, us the select(~)
method or the find_all(~)
method.
Consider the following HTML document:
my_html = """ <html> <p gender="male">Alex</p> <p gender="male">Bob</p> <p gender="female">Cathy</p> </html>"""
soup = BeautifulSoup(my_html)
Elements that contain an attribute
To find elements that contain the attribute "gender"
:
Note that the square bracket in CSS denotes attributes.
Elements with an attribute value
To find elements that have value "male"
for the "gender"
attribute:
Equivalently, you could also use the find_all(~)
method for this:
print(el)
<p gender="male">Alex</p><p gender="male">Bob</p>
